All the highlights from Capital's Summertime Ball 2026 with Barclaycard are now available to relive. The curtain has closed on one of the biggest music events of the year, but the memories will last forever.
Opening Spectacular by Take That
Take That kicked off the show with a sensational five-song set, reminding everyone why they are one of the UK's greatest bands. From the stirring 'Patience' to the nostalgic 'Never Forget', fans were captivated by Gary Barlow, Mark Owen, and Howard Donald.
Bebe Rexha's Live Vocals Shine
Bebe Rexha proved why she is a dancefloor diva with pitch-perfect renditions of her hits. She also debuted her new collaboration with David Guetta, 'Sad Girls', live for the first time.
MEEK's Debut Performance
After breaking the internet with 'Fabulous', MEEK delivered an electrifying show, including a cover of Tame Impala's 'Dracula'.
Jason Derulo Gets Everyone Moving
Jason Derulo performed a mega mix of his biggest hits, including 'Want to Want Me', 'Savage Love', and 'Talk Dirty', ending with a shirtless finale.
Sekou Wins Over the Crowd
As the first Capital Buzz Artist, Sekou impressed with 'Dangerous Lover' and 'Catching Bodies', plus a stunning cover of Adele's 'Someone Like You'.
Robyn's Timeless Appeal
Robyn reminded fans why she is a pop icon, with 80,000 people singing along to 'Dancing On My Own' and tracks from her new album 'Sexistential'.
Lola Young's Emotional Return
After technical issues in 2025, Lola Young returned with an emotional speech about overcoming challenges before performing 'From Down Here' and her hit 'Messy'.
December 10's Debut
December 10 made their Summertime Ball debut with a cover of Djo's 'End of Beginning', showcasing their talent.
Stephen Sanchez Charms the Audience
Stephen Sanchez performed 'Until I Found You', solidifying his status as one of music's rising stars.
Fatboy Slim's Rave Set
Fatboy Slim delivered a non-stop bangers set, recreating the feel of raving with 80,000 people.
XG Makes History
XG became the first Japanese group to play at Wembley Stadium, performing hits like 'Hypnotize' and a cover of 'Flowers'.
Niall Horan's Surprise Guest
Niall Horan performed tracks from his new album 'Dinner Party' and surprised the crowd with a One Direction cover and a guest appearance by Myles Smith.
Sienna Spiro's Stunning Set
Sienna Spiro showcased her incredible voice with 'Die on this Hill' and 'Material Lover', ahead of her debut album 'Visitor'.
Mis-Teeq's Reunion
Fresh from Britain's Got Talent, Mis-Teeq performed as the Barclaycard Out of the Blue act, with hits like 'One Night Stand' and 'Scandalous'.
Myles Smith's Iconic Set
Myles Smith delivered a set packed with his biggest hits, including 'Stargazing' and 'Nice To Meet You'.
Calvin Harris Turns Wembley into Ibiza
Calvin Harris brought the bangers with tracks like 'This Is What You Came For', 'We Found Love', and 'Summer'.
RAYE Closes the Show
RAYE closed the Summertime Ball with a masterclass performance, opening with 'Escapism' and ending with 'Where Is My Husband' amid confetti and fireworks.
